对应oracle生成java对象,Java学习笔记(十三)——通过Netbeans开发环境生成oracle数据库中表的对应hibernate映射文件...
【前面的話】
身體慢慢已經(jīng)快好了,感覺(jué)真好,哈哈。
這篇文章要通過(guò)Hibernate對(duì)數(shù)據(jù)庫(kù)進(jìn)行操作,而Netbeans可以直接通過(guò)數(shù)據(jù)庫(kù)逆向生成對(duì)應(yīng)的映射文件。基礎(chǔ)文章,選擇性閱讀。
【步驟】
1、 在netbeans中選擇服務(wù),點(diǎn)擊數(shù)據(jù)庫(kù),選擇建立連接
2、 我要使用的是oracle,所以我選擇Oracle Thin。需要加入連接的jar包,點(diǎn)擊添加,然后加入就行了。點(diǎn)擊下一步。
3、 輸入主機(jī)名,端口號(hào),服務(wù)ID,用戶名,口令。
我使用的是遠(yuǎn)端的數(shù)據(jù)庫(kù)所以我輸入的主機(jī)就是:195.xx.xx.xx
端口號(hào),服務(wù)ID,用戶名,口令等依次輸入就可以了。
輸入好以后點(diǎn)擊下一步:
4、 選擇方案,一般就是默認(rèn)方案。點(diǎn)擊finish
5、 可以在數(shù)據(jù)庫(kù)下面看到自己建立的這個(gè)鏈接。
6、 建立一個(gè)java project。
7、 在新建的項(xiàng)目上面,點(diǎn)擊右鍵,選擇其他,點(diǎn)擊hibernate
8、 選擇文件類型中的Hibernate 配置向?qū)А|c(diǎn)擊下一步。選擇你剛剛建立的那條鏈接,點(diǎn)擊完成。
9、 你就會(huì)發(fā)現(xiàn)你建立的java project就有一個(gè)新的文件了。
10、 和上面一樣,在新建的項(xiàng)目上面,點(diǎn)擊右鍵,選擇其他,點(diǎn)擊hibernate,選擇Hibernate 逆向工程向?qū)?。點(diǎn)擊下一步,再點(diǎn)一次下一步。
11、 選擇你要進(jìn)行轉(zhuǎn)換的數(shù)據(jù)庫(kù)表。進(jìn)行添加。點(diǎn)擊完成。
12、 現(xiàn)在你應(yīng)該有兩個(gè)文件如下圖,如果沒(méi)有的話,到你建立項(xiàng)目的文件夾下面,把這兩個(gè)文件拷貝到scr文件夾下面。
13、 和上面一樣,在新建的項(xiàng)目上面,點(diǎn)擊右鍵,選擇其他,點(diǎn)擊hibernate,選擇通過(guò)數(shù)據(jù)庫(kù)生成Hibernate映射文件和POJO。點(diǎn)擊下一步
14、 輸入包名,建議和你實(shí)際項(xiàng)目中的包名一樣。點(diǎn)擊完成.
15、 就會(huì)發(fā)現(xiàn)已經(jīng)生成Hibernate映射文件和POJO.
【后面的話】
時(shí)間好快。
——TT
https://www.cnblogs.com/xt0810/category/549237.html
總結(jié)
以上是生活随笔為你收集整理的对应oracle生成java对象,Java学习笔记(十三)——通过Netbeans开发环境生成oracle数据库中表的对应hibernate映射文件...的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
- 上一篇: 学霸女神冯净冰:我是如何从复旦走到诺奖获
- 下一篇: instring java_Decode